Dr. Vahe Shahnazarian, MD is a gastroenterologist in Staten Island, NY and has over 10 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Shahnazarian has extensive experience in Pancreatic Disease. He graduated from Ross University, Roseau in 2012. He is affiliated with Richmond University Medical Center. He is accepting new patients.
